Hello, a friend and I are starting a property management business very soon. We both have our real estate license and understand how important it is to have a great property management company looking over people’s assets and we want to be one of those great companies. Can any investors out there tell me what do they look for when hiring a property Management company. Thanks a lot! Here is some services and key points will we build our company on.

-Comprehensive Marketing and Advertising

-Owner Deposit- No Delay Fund deposit to owner

-Schedule Rent Increases

-Recommend market rate rent cost

-Strict tenant Screening & Selection

-Monthly record Keeping/Statement

-Cost-Effective and Reliable maintenance

-Lease Law Compliance

-Regular “Common Area” Inspection

-24 Hour Online Access To Parking

-Rent Collection

-Lease Renewal (3 month notice)

-New Tenant 60 day Inspection

-Handle all tenant calls, emails, and texts

-Owner Communication

-Property up keeping including lawn care
